Brigade Group launches first plotted development project in East Bengaluru

Realty Developer Brigade Group, based in Bengaluru, has signed a Joint Development Agreement (JDA) for an approximate value of ₹ 175 million rupees for a development project drawn up in Malur, Eastern Bengaluru. This marks the first development project of Brigade Group in East Bangalore, strengthening its presence in one of the expanding residential corridors of the city.

The project will cover approximately 20 acres, and a potential for total development or 0.45 million square feet.

When commenting on development, Pavitra Shankar, managing director of Brigade Enterprises Limited, said: “We continually identify high potential land plots that are aligned with our long -term vision of creating well planned accessions. Well connected and affordable life options beyond the city’s nucleus.

The company’s shares closed to ₹ 1,011.50, 2.63 percent more in the EEB.
